Longley Park DGC 2+ years drive by

Reviewed: Played on:Oct 20, 2010 Played the course:once

Pros:

There are a few holes that have plenty of trees for a challenge. The baskets are nice. The concrete tee pads are in good condition.

Cons:

There were some missing signs. The park waas being setup for some sort of Halloween walk, and many of the baskets were blocked with the Halloween displays. I had to give up on holes 9-13, because they were not playable. There were people working on the Halloween setup, and vehicles were parked in fairways.

Holes 17 and 18 are terrible. The softball field is out of bounds, and if you go to the right on 17, you are in the street or in an apartment complex. If there was a softball game in progress, this would be a 16 hole course in my book. This park has the typical problems of a multi-use park.

Other Thoughts:

For a first time player, it is hard to figure out where the next tee is on many of the holes. I had to search a while to find 17's tee.

Don't expect to play all 18 holes around Halloween.
